WebMay 10, 2024 · A fund that has an expense ratio of .20% costs the equivalent of 0.002 of the amount you have invested. A fund with an expense ratio of 1.10% each year costs 0.011 of the total assets you have in the fund. A fund that charges 30 basis points charges .30%, or 0.003 of the amount you have invested per year.

For instance, in the first year ... quotes about teachers being the futureWebJun 1, 2024 · An important concept in the accounting for investments is whether a gain or loss has been realized. A realized gain is achieved by the sale of an investment, as is a realized loss.
